Using Excel 2003, I am creating a pivot table using customer data similar to
the following:

Customer Location Interface Code
11 Word 123
12 Excel
13 Outlook 456
21 Word
22 Excel ABC
23 Outlook XYZ

I am placing the Customer Location in the row area, the Interface in the
column area and the Code in the data area. I would like the Code to show in
the pivot table as the quot;123quot;, quot;456quot;, quot;ABCquot;, and quot;XYZquot;. I don't want a count
of those values, I just want the actual values to print in the pivot table.
Is this possible?

PivotTables are designed to aggregate data so the data area can only contain
some kind of summation (or count, or standard devitation, etc.)
